Robotics Revolutionizing Rehabilitation: Pepper the Robot Arrives in Galatina
The future of patient care is taking shape in Galatina, Italy, with the introduction of Pepper, a humanoid robot designed to assist medical professionals in rehabilitation. This innovative technology, deployed at the “Santa Caterina Novella” Hospital’s Neuromotor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ation Department, marks a significant step towards integrating robotics into everyday healthcare practices.
Beyond Assistance: How Pepper Enhances Therapy
Pepper isn’t intended to replace doctors or therapists. Instead, it’s designed to augment their capabilities. The robot interacts with patients through voice, movement, and visual cues, making therapy more engaging, and measurable. This is achieved through the RoboMate software, a certified medical device (Class I CE) that allows healthcare professionals to program, monitor, and personalize therapeutic activities.
The core benefit lies in Pepper’s ability to capture and maintain patient attention, encouraging active participation in rehabilitation exercises. This is particularly valuable in geriatric care, where maintaining engagement can be a significant challenge.
RoboMate: The ‘Brain’ Behind the Operation
RoboMate isn’t just a control system; it’s a comprehensive platform for managing the entire rehabilitation process. It allows clinicians to create individualized patient profiles, track progress, and collect valuable clinical data. This data-driven approach enables more informed decision-making and optimized treatment plans.
The software also facilitates the administration of standardized neuropsychological tests, guiding patients through each step of the process. This ensures consistency and accuracy in assessments.
A Collaborative Approach: Human Control Remains Paramount
A key aspect of Pepper’s implementation is maintaining full human control. The robot supports doctors in administering tests, assists therapists during rehabilitation activities, and standardizes procedures. Yet, all clinical decisions remain firmly in the hands of the medical professional.
The Future of Robot-Assisted Therapy
The arrival of Pepper in Galatina is not an isolated event. It represents a growing trend towards utilizing robotics to improve healthcare outcomes. The Augmented and Virtual Reality Laboratory (AVR Lab) at the University of Salento, the creators of Pepper, are at the forefront of this movement.
This technology has the potential to address several challenges facing healthcare systems globally, including:
- Aging Populations: Robots can provide consistent and engaging therapy for elderly patients, helping them maintain independence and quality of life.
- Staff Shortages: Robots can assist with repetitive tasks, freeing up healthcare professionals to focus on more complex patient needs.
- Personalized Medicine: RoboMate’s data collection and analysis capabilities enable highly personalized treatment plans.
